Stop Working Out on an Empty Stomach: What You Need to Know

Fit woman in garden preparing to work out on empty stomach.

Is Working Out on an Empty Stomach Really a No-Go?

Many of us have heard advice suggesting that exercising on an empty stomach can torch fat more efficiently. But what does science really say? In the video "Do you work out on an empty stomach? Stop it." We explore the potential pitfalls of this popular fitness practice and why skipping breakfast might not be as beneficial as it seems.

In "Do you work out on an empty stomach? Stop it." The discussion dives into the common practice of exercising on an empty stomach and its implications, prompting us to explore the science and provide insights on what really works.

The Science Behind Fasting and Exercising

Working out without food in the belly means your body may pull energy from fat stores rather than carbohydrates. This sounds appealing, doesn’t it? But it’s crucial to note that your body also relies on glycogen—stored carbohydrates in your muscles and liver—for higher-intensity workouts. When glycogen levels dip, your performance might falter, leading to fatigue faster than you’d prefer.

Physical Performance: Why Fueling Up Is Key

More than just a theory, numerous studies indicate that pre-workout meals can enhance physical performance. Consuming a balanced meal beforehand can help maintain energy, improve endurance, and even enhance recovery post-exercise. Eating a healthy breakfast doesn’t just prevent you from feeling faint; it sets you up for a more productive workout session, enabling you to push those weights a little harder or run that extra mile.

Addressing Common Misconceptions About Fasting Workouts

There’s a myth that working out on an empty stomach aids in weight loss. While it might seem logical, failing to eat can often lead to overeating later on. If hunger pangs hit midway through your session, chances are you'll snack more liberally after the workout, negating any calorie deficit you may have created. Knowledge is power, and the reality is that mindful eating and proper hydration are far more effective strategies for long-term weight management than fasting workouts.

What Makes a Great Pre-Workout Snack?

So, you’re convinced to eat before your workout? Great choice! Ideally, your pre-workout meal should include carbs and a bit of protein. Think smoothies, oatmeal, or yogurt with fruits. These options are nutritious and lightweight enough to keep you fueled without feeling sluggish. Aim for options that will sit well in your stomach, as too heavy a meal might lead to discomfort.

The Role of Hydration in Fitness

In addition to considering what to eat before working out, let’s not forget hydration. Dehydration can sour even the best fitness plans. Make sure to hydrate before exercising, as it can significantly improve your performance too.

Conclusion: Listen to Your Body

Ultimately, understanding your body’s unique needs is essential when determining your workout routine and meal timing. If you feel more energized and perform better after a small meal, then that’s the right choice for you. For anyone wanting to embark on a fitness journey, remember: prioritizing nutrition and hydration can help you achieve your goals while keeping your body happy.

So, the next time you think about hitting the gym on an empty stomach, consider fueling up a bit instead. You’ll likely feel stronger, more focused, and ready to embrace your workout session!

Unwind and Recharge: Explore the Best Spa Hotels in the UK

Update Unwind in Style: Discover the Best Spa Hotels in the UK In a world that constantly demands our attention, taking a step back to recharge and rejuvenate is crucial for our well-being. The UK boasts an array of exquisite spa hotels, catering to various tastes—from luxurious city retreats to tranquil countryside escapes. Whether you're seeking a few days of pampering or just a serene escape, these top selections promise to provide much more than just a place to rest your head. City Boltholes: Revive Your Spirit in Urban Retreats For those looking to blend relaxation with metropolitan allure, spa hotels in cities like London and Manchester offer the perfect solution. Places like the Rosewood London stand out with their elegant interiors and comprehensive spa services. Guests can indulge in treatments that draw on a variety of global traditions, designed not just for relaxation, but for revitalizing the spirit. With a range of wellness programs focusing on both physical and mental health, city-based spas provide a convenient escape without straying far from urban life. Countryside Wellness Retreats: Serenity at Its Best If fresh air and scenic views are what you seek, look no further than the countryside wellness retreats, such as the Chewton Glen in Dorset. Nestled in the heart of nature, these destinations typically offer a unique blend of relaxation and outdoor adventure. Surrounded by lush gardens and beautiful landscapes, guests can enjoy everything from holistic spa treatments to guided forest walks, promoting both mental and physical well-being. Country spas offer ample opportunities for relaxation, while also tapping into the rejuvenating power of nature. Historic Charm Meets Modern Wellness Some of the best spa hotels in the UK embrace their historical backgrounds while providing top-of-the-line wellness services. Hotels like The Lygon Arms in the Cotswolds combine Elizabethan charm with modern luxuries. Guests can unwind in outdoor hot tubs, experiment with a variety of beauty treatments, or even participate in yoga sessions that harness the tranquility of their surroundings. These historic venues not only transport guests back in time but also offer a unique space where past and present harmoniously create the perfect atmosphere for relaxation. Unique Treatments and Experiences to Explore What sets many of these spa hotels apart are their uniquely tailored experiences. Some places offer treatments that incorporate local ingredients, promoting sustainability and wellness. For instance, many spas include herbal remedies derived from local flora in their spa therapies. This approach not only supports local agriculture but also connects spa-goers to the very essence of the area, enhancing the overall experience. Engaging with the local culture through wellness treatments serves to deepen the rejuvenating experience. Take Time to Pamper Yourself Visiting a spa hotel is not just about enjoying luxurious treatments; it’s an opportunity to prioritize your health and well-being. Whether opting for a solo retreat or a getaway with friends, taking valuable time to relax can have lasting positive effects on your mental health. Consider how stepping away from your daily routine—even for just a weekend—can recharge your perspective and bring harmony back into your life. Conclusion: Embrace the Wellness Journey As you explore the best spa hotels in the UK, remember that wellness is a journey, not a destination. Embrace every moment to pamper yourself and reconnect with your mind, body, and spirit. Choose a location that speaks to you, whether amidst the vibrant life of the urban scene or the tranquil landscapes of the countryside. Investing in your well-being today can yield a more balanced and joyful tomorrow.

Unlocking the Workout Secrets of Anne Hathaway and Her Co-Stars

Update Unveiling the Secrets Behind Anne Hathaway’s Fitness Journey The excitement surrounding the release of The Devil Wears Prada 2 has many fans eager to catch up with the beloved characters, but the vibrant energy of its cast, particularly Anne Hathaway, is equally captivating. Renowned for her impressive transformation from the awkward ‘Andy Sachs’ into a poised and glamorous figure, Hathaway has made a lasting impression with her dedication to fitness. Training Secrets from Monique Eastwood Monique Eastwood, who has been coaching Anne Hathaway along with her co-stars Emily Blunt and Stanley Tucci, plays a pivotal role in their fitness journeys. With a background in ballet, Eastwood’s approach melds diverse techniques, including dance, Pilates, yoga, and high-intensity interval training (HIIT), to create dynamic workouts that keep her clients engaged. "My goal is to make workouts feel less like a chore and more like an energizing experience," Eastwood shares. The Impact of Consistency and Variety Consistency in workouts paired with a variety of movements appears to be the secret sauce for Hathaway’s and her co-stars' dramatic physiques. Eastwood crafts her sessions to focus on different core elements like mobility, strength, and balance, which enhances their overall physical capabilities. "Each workout session is structured to promote bodily awareness, endurance, and a sense of accomplishment," she explains. A Well-Rounded Regimen for the Modern Lifestyle But how do they maintain this regimen amidst their busy schedules? Hathaway emphasizes the importance of adapting her fitness routine to fit her dynamic lifestyle. "Every time I have a film role, I elevate my training intensity, switching things up from my usual schedule to achieve my fitness goals,” she says, echoing sentiments shared by other top trainers she has worked with, such as Ramona Braganza. Embracing Fun in Fitness The essence of Eastwood’s workouts lies in their enjoyment factor. Hathaway appreciates how they are packed with energy and creativity, contrasting traditional, monotonous gym routines. This approach not only enhances physical fitness but also positively influences mental well-being. Hathaway states, "My outlook on life has improved through our work together." It’s this sense of joy that motivates her and keeps her returning to the mat. Fashion Meets Function: Workout Insights from Hathaway As they prepare for red-carpet moments, the cast's fitness journeys do indeed revolve around aesthetics, but it’s much more than just looks. They are striving for physical resilience. When Hathaway stumbled in heels during a scene, Eastwood took pride in how quickly she recovered, crediting her workout routine for building resilience and agility. Takeaway Tips for Your Own Fitness Journey For those looking to emulate Hathaway’s path to fitness, consider integrating some of Eastwood’s tips into your routine. Engage in varied training that keeps your interest piqued, allowing flexibility to adapt based on your mood. Morning workouts, coupled with energizing music, can harness endorphins to set a positive tone to your day. Experiment with unique movements that resonate with you, like dance or Pilates, to make fitness a source of joy rather than a punishment. Unleash Your Strength: 20-Minute Bodyweight Workout for Busy Lives

Update The Power of Bodyweight Training: Why It’s Perfect for Busy Lifestyles For many busy men and women, squeezing a workout into an already packed schedule can feel overwhelming. Fortunately, bodyweight training offers a flexible and effective solution. Unlike traditional strength training, which often requires gym equipment, bodyweight exercises can be performed anywhere and anytime—making it the ideal choice for those juggling work, family, and other commitments.In the video '20 minute Abs, Arms, Back & Chest BODYWEIGHT Workout for Upper Body Strength', we explore an efficient fitness routine that highlights effective bodyweight exercises. We’re diving deeper into its significance and how you can maximize your workout experience. The Benefits of a 20-Minute Workout The 20-minute upper body and core workout featured in the video titled "20 minute Abs, Arms, Back & Chest BODYWEIGHT Workout for Upper Body Strength" is a prime example of how short, targeted exercise can yield significant results. Busy schedules shouldn't compromise your fitness goals. Research shows that even brief, intensive workouts can improve cardiovascular health, build strength, and enhance flexibility. Plus, when completed consistently, short workouts build habits that lead to long-term success. Getting Started: Preparation for Success Before diving into a workout, it’s essential to prepare both your mind and body. The warm-up in the video is a crucial step that prepares your muscles for the session ahead. A good warming routine increases blood flow and reduces the risk of injury, allowing you to move into strength-building exercises effectively. As emphasized in the video, take the time to find a range of motion that feels comfortable, and remember that it’s okay to modify movements as needed. Cooling Down: The Importance of Recovery After completing a workout like the one presented, cooling down is equally important. This helps your body transition back to its resting state and prevents stiffness. The video recommends stretches that target major muscle groups. Incorporating cooldowns into your routine not only aids recovery but also enhances your overall flexibility over time. Connecting Fitness with Everyday Life Fitness should be a part of your daily life rather than a chore. As you establish a routine with bodyweight training, consider integrating movements into your daily activities. For example, doing wall push-ups while waiting for a pot to boil or incorporating squats when you're brushing your teeth can uniquely bolster your strength training. Finding these connections between movement and everyday tasks can help you stay engaged with your fitness journey. Future Trends in Fitness: Embracing Bodyweight Training As health trends evolve, bodyweight training continues to grow in popularity. More people are discovering its effectiveness, especially in times when access to gyms may be limited. For many, bodyweight training is not just a trend but a means of specifically tailoring fitness to their lifestyles. Whether you are traveling, at home, or in the park, the versatility of bodyweight workouts, like the one demonstrated in the video, makes it easy to maintain a consistent exercise regimen.
